About the role#
This paid, part-time internship offers an inside look at the film distribution industry. You will support the GKIDS distribution department by managing licensing, exhibition logistics, and theater bookings across the country. This role provides insight into how film programmers operate and how operational systems support the release of globally inspired cinema.
What you'll do#
- Create and manage a high volume of booking records in Airtable.
- Review and maintain various spreadsheets for accuracy.
- Coordinate the timely fulfillment of film materials, such as DCPs and Blu-rays, to exhibitors.
- Manage the shipment of in-theater promotional items like posters and postcards.
- Update and maintain the bookings calendar.
- Pull and compile pre-sale ticketing reports.
- Assist with sales materials including email newsletters and pitch decks.
- Maintain operational systems and analyze performance metrics.
- Stay informed on new releases, industry news, and market trends.

About Toho International, Inc.
Toho International, Inc. operates as the United States subsidiary of Toho Company, Limited. The company manages and commercializes an intellectual property portfolio centered on the Godzilla brand. Based in Los Angeles, the firm employs 49 people. It was founded in 1953.
